What Coworking Spaces Usually Need

Most coworking spaces do not need prime storefront retail. They usually need quiet office suites that support confidential meetings, staff workstations, secure storage, and easy client visits.

Signage
Suite or monument signage is helpful; storefront frontage is optional
Best Layout
open desks + private offices + conference rooms + kitchen
Typical Size
2,000–5,000 SF — solo and small firms on the low end; larger teams on the high end
Parking Priority
Easy client parking matters more than drive-by traffic
Move In Readiness
Second-generation office suites are usually the lowest-risk option
Key Infrastructure
Reliable internet, quiet HVAC, ADA access, and secure storage

What Drives Cost for Coworking Space in Pasco

Most coworking spaces in Pasco lease existing office suites, so total cost depends less on square footage alone and more on location, existing buildout, and what is included in the lease.

Lease type you will likely see

Many small office suites are quoted as full service or modified gross. Always confirm whether utilities, janitorial, CAM/NNN, after-hours HVAC, and internet are included.

What pushes cost up

Newer buildings, stronger corridors, premium finishes, better signage, reserved parking, and suites that need custom layout changes usually increase total occupancy cost.

What keeps cost down

Second-generation office suites, older but functional office stock, simpler signage, and minimal buildout usually reduce up-front cost and speed up occupancy.

What to compare before you choose

Ask for the estimated all-in monthly occupancy cost, not just the quoted rent. Two office suites with similar asking rent can have very different real monthly totals.

How Leasing a Coworking Space Usually Works

If this is your first commercial lease, this is the sequence most coworking spaces follow in Pasco.

  1. 1

    Clarify size, budget, and timing

    Decide how many offices, workstations, client meeting spaces, and file/storage areas you need, plus your budget and target move-in date.

  2. 2

    Review matching office suites

    We narrow the market to spaces that fit your size, parking needs, preferred area, and lease budget.

  3. 3

    Tour the best options

    Compare layout, parking, signage, suite condition, and total monthly cost — not just the quoted rent.

  4. 4

    Make an offer

    Your broker helps you submit a short offer letter, often called an LOI, covering rent, lease term, requested improvements, and move-in timing.

  5. 5

    Finalize the lease and improvements

    For many coworking spaces, the best option is second-generation office suites with light cosmetic work rather than a full custom buildout.

  6. 6

    Set up and move in

    Confirm internet, furniture, signage, records storage, and opening timeline before taking occupancy.

Should I lease second-generation office suites?

In most cases, yes. A suite that already has private offices, reception, and basic infrastructure can save $15,000–40,000 in buildout costs and get you open 30–60 days faster than raw space.

How long does the leasing process usually take in Pasco?

For a second-generation suite that needs minimal work, most coworking spaces go from first tour to move-in in 30–60 days. If the space needs layout changes or landlord improvements, expect 60–120 days.
